Iran-India trade balance to hit $16bln despite sanctions

2013-05-21 10:48:38

Iran and India are set to increase the volume of their trade balance to $16 billion despite the US-led western sanctions against Tehran, media reports said.

The value of India's imports from Iran stood at $11bln during the last financial year (ended March 31), but the value of its exports to the Islamic Republic hit $2.95bln, The Wall Street Journal reported.

"India aims to raise the value of its exports to Iran to around $5bln in the current financial year (started April 1)," the newspaper quoted Director-General of the Federation of Indian Export Organization Ajai Sahai as saying.

Sahai noted that India is looking to broaden its range of exports to Iran to help balance bilateral trade under an agreement that allows the countries to bypass Western sanctions.

India is one of the largest buyers of Iran's crude oil and so far 85%-90% of India's exports to Iran have been agricultural products such as basmati rice and soymeal, the Journal wrote.

But now, India plans to also export products such as textiles, pharmaceuticals, medical-diagnostic equipment, auto components and consumer goods, it added.

"We are looking at diversification of our exports," Sahai said.
